Galápagos Islands in August
August in the Galápagos offers a unique window into a wilder archipelago. This is the start of the garúa season, meaning cooler temperatures and a misty, ethereal quality to the islands, often revealing more marine life as plankton blooms.
Is August a good time to visit Galápagos Islands?
August is a workable month for Galápagos Islands with tradeoffs. 21-26°C, cool and dry, with overcast skies common. — Still part of the peak season.
What makes August worth visiting
- •Penguin breeding continues
- •Sea lion pups are active
